Microsoft Translator app now supports Tamil text translation feature

Microsoft on Wednesday announced that its translator app now supports Tamil translation in Office 365. It currently supports Indian languages such as Bengali and Hindi. The app is available on Android, iOS and Windows platforms.

With this addition, users can now translate through “Bing Translator” website, “Microsoft Translator” apps, “PowerPoint” add-ins and API on Azure in over 60 text translation languages and 10 speech translation languages.

People using Tamil language can listen to people speaking in the same language and see the translated text on their device with the help of Microsoft Translator app. It can also read text from photo or menus, signs, brochures and show the translation in Tamil, adds Microsoft.

The new addition will enable Tamil users get directions, order food at restaurants, and use the built-in “Phrasebook” feature to greet people.
